It also works as a safeguard for insulation failures These appliances need to be earthed/ grounded to avoid the risk of electrocution in case there is an electricity leakage to the metal body. This type of plug is generally used for class III electrical appliances such as refrigerators, microwave ovens and especially those with metal bodies. It is important to know how to wire a 3-pin plug correctly. This is used when the appliance has a metal casing to take any current away, in case if the live wire comes in contact with the casing.Ī 3-pin plug consists of three pins (hence the name). The EARTH wire is represented as GREEN & YELLOW this is the route the electric current takes when it exits an appliance it is for this reason the neutral wire has a voltage close to zero.
